Significant milestone not only for Hornbill Skyways but also Sarawak

BY AWANG MUHAMMAD SYAHMI & SARAH HAFIZAH CHANDRA KUCHING: Hornbill Skyways Sdn Bhd, an experienced aviation company owned by the Sarawak government, has reached a significant milestone by securing a five-year contract from Petronas for Offshore Helicopter Services (OHS). Sarawak’s boutique airline expected to operate in three months

By Natasha Jee & Gabriel Lihan KUCHING: The operation of Sarawak’s own airline is awaiting licence approval from the Ministry of Transport (MOT) and is expected to ‘take-off’ within the next three months. Armed forces help with food aid

SIBU: The state government and the Malaysian Armed Forces (ATM) are joining hands to deliver food aid to rural communities during the movement control order (MCO) period.  The Malaysian Army’s Eastern Command has been appointed as a focal agency to coordinate and assist in the delivery of food supplies to rural areas in Sarawak.
